 Elks Kids Week - Terms, Conditions and Helpful Hints

PLEASE NOTE: THIS PAGE IS ONLY FOR KIDS REGISTERING FROM THE ALEXANDRIA ELKS LODGE #1685
Please review the important payment, refund and cancellation policies below. 
PAYMENT INFORMATION
The camper fee is being handled by the Alexandria Lodge.  

REFUND POLICY
In the unfortunate event of a cancellation, we would like you to consider switching to another session if there are any openings. However, we understand that things come up and you may need to cancel all together. To do so, please call or email us with this information so that we can assign the slot to another child.

MEDICAL REASON FOR CANCELLATION
We understand that medical issues may arise over the summer or just as your child is set to attend camp.  Please call us as soon as possible to inform us of your need to cancel.  We will ask that you submit a written excuse from your child's physician.  If your child is sick and there is time and room, we will work with you to switch your camper to a later session. 

ELKS CHILD vs. NON-ELKS CHILD

The Elks Kids Week session is intended for the children, grandchildren, nieces and/or nephews of current Elks members of Minnesota (denoted as "Elks Kids"). We also provide a mechanism for Elks Kids to bring along a friend or two who are not related to Elks members (denoted as "Non Elks Kids"). The registration fees and waiting list priority assignment varies based on whether the child is an "Elks Child" or a "Non Elks Child". 

OLDER / YOUNGER CHILDREN
If you have a child that is younger or older than our 9-13 age limits, you can still register your child on a wait list. Please select the  session you wish the child to attend at checkout. Your child will be put on a wait list and you will be notified at a later date if space is available.

WAIT LISTS
If the session that you desire is full, you can still fill out the form to register your child but a space will NOT be allocated until you have heard from the Camp regarding the wait list. Wait lists are on a first come first serve basis. 

REQUIRED MEDICAL FORMS
Please download the medical form here, fill it out and have it with your child when the child arrives at camp.

REGISTERING MULTIPLE CHILDREN
If you are registering multiple children, you must go through the registration form once for each child.
